Устройство для анализа параметров сетей

 

Изобретение относится к вычислительной технике и может быть использовано для анализа путей в сетях. Целью изобретения является расширение функциональных возможностей устройства за счет определения узких мест в пути между начальной и конечной вершинами сети. С этой целью устройство содержит генератор 1 импульсов, распределитель 2 импульсов, группу из Р триггеров 3, где Р - количество ребер в сети, группу из Р элементов И4, вход 5 разрешения работы устройства, элемент НЕ6, модели 7 ребер, элементы 8 индикации, ключи 9, блок 10 определения связных вершин сети и вход 11 пуска уа. Перед началом работы выходы триггеров 3 соединяют с управляющими входами ключей 9 в порядке возрастания весов ребер сети. Триггеры 3 устанавливают в единичное состояние. На вход 5 устройства подают сигнал уровня логической единицы. После запуска генератора 1 импульсов первый из триггеров 3, сохранивший до останова генератора 1 свое единичное состояние, укажет "узкое" место в пути между начальной и конечной вершинами графа. Включенные элементы 8 индикации фиксируют путь между указанными вершинами, в котором длина кратчайшей дуги/"узкое" место/ максимальна. 1 ил.

СОЮЗ СОВЕТСКИХ

СОЦИАЛИСТИЧЕСНИХ

РЕСПУБЛИК

ÄÄSUÄÄ 1476483 А1 (51)4 С 06 F 15/20, G 06 G 7/122

ОпНСАННЕ ИЗОБРЕТЕНИЯ

К ABTOPCHOMV СВИДЕТЕЛЬСТВУ

ГОСУДАРСТВЕННЫЙ НОМИТЕТ

ПО ИЗОБРЕТЕНИЯМ И OTHPblTHRM

ПРИ ГННТ СССР (21) 4207818/24-24 (22) 09.03.87 (46) 30.04.89. Бюл. У 16 (72) Г.С.Колесник (53) 681.333(088.8) (56) Авторское свидетельство СССР

У 553628, кл. G 06 G 7/122, 1975.

Авторское свидетельство СССР

У 276538, кл. G 06 G 7/122, 1969. (54) УСТРОЙСТВО ДЛЯ АНАЛИЗА ПАРАМЕТ-

РОВ СЕТЕЙ (57) Изобретение относится к вычислительной технике и может быть использовано для анализа путей в сетях. Целью изобретения является расширение функциональных возможностей устройства за счет определения узких

1476483

20 мест в пути между начальной и конечной вершинами сети. С этой целью устройство содержит генератор 1 импульсов, распределитель 2 импульсов, группу из P триггеров 3, где Р— количество ребер в сети, группу иэ

P элементов И 4, вход 5 разрешения работы устройства, элемент НЕ 6, модели 7 ребер, элементы 8 индикации, ключи 9, блок 10 определения связных вершин сети и вход 11 пуска устройства. Перед началом работы выходы триггеров 3 соединяют с управляющими входами ключей 9 в порядке возраста1

Изобретение относится к вычислительной технике и может быть использовано для анализа путей в сетях.

Цель изобретения — расширение функциональных возможностей устрой" ства за счет определения узких мест в пути между начальной и конечной вершинами сети.

На чертеже представлена функциональная схема устройства. 10

Устройство содержит генератор 1 импульсов, распределитель 2 импульсов, группу из P триггеров 3 (где

Р— количество ребер в сети), группу из P элементов И 4, вход 5 разре- 15 шения работы устройства, элемент

НЕ 6, модели 7 ребер, элементы 8 индикации, ключи 9, блок 10 определения связных вершин сети и вход 11 пуска устройства.

Устройство работает следующим образом, Перед началом работы выходы триггеров 3 соединяют с управляющими входами ключей 9 в порядке поэрастания весов ребер, а именно выход первого триггера 3 соединяется с управляющим входом ключа 9 той модели 7, соответствующее ребро графа которой имеет наименьший вес, выход второго ®0 триггера 3 — с управляющим входом ключа 9 модели 7 следующего наименьшего по весу ребра и т.д., так что выход P-го триггера 3 соединяется с управляющим входом ключа 9 модели 7 ребра наибольшего веса. Вход 5 и ния весов ребер сети. Триггеры 3 устанавливают в единичное состояние.

На вход 5 устройства подают сигнал логической единицы. После запуска генератора 1 импульсов первый из триггеров 3, сохранивший до останона генератора 1 свое единичное состояние, укажет узкое место в пути ,между начальной и конечной вершинами гофра. Включенные элементы 8 индикации фиксируют путь между указанными вершинами, в котором длина кратчайшей дуги (узкое место) максимальна. 1 ил„

2 элемент НЕ 6 подключают к начальной и конечной вершинам сети, в пути между которыми требуется найти узкое место. Распределитель 2 обнуляют, все триггеры 3 устанавливаются в единичное состояние, поэтому все ключи 9 открыты и включены все элементы индикации 8.

После подачи пускового сигнала на вход 11 генератор 1 начинает выдачу импульсов на тактовый вход распределителя 2, который поочередно выдает сигналы на свои выходы.

Дальнейшую работу устройства рассмотрим на примере графа с вершинами А — Д, представленного на чертеже, причем работа (А, Б), (А, В), (Б, В), (Б, Г) (В, Г), (Вр Д) и (Г, Д) имеют веса 6, 4, 1, 3, 7, 2 и 5 соответственно. Импульс с первого выхода распределителя 2 поступает на вход установки в ноль первого триггера 3 и устанавливает его в нулевое состояние. Сигнал с выхода первого триггера 3 поступает на управляющий вход ключа 9 модели 7 и закрывает его, что равносильно исключению ребра (Б, В) из топологии сети. Так как при этом вершины А и Д остаются связанными, первый триггер

3 остается в нулевом состоянии.

Далее распределитель 2 выдает импульс по второму, а затем по третьему выходу, обусловливая переход в нулевое состояние второго и третьего триггеров 3, закрытие ключей 9 мо1476483 (1, Д), соответствующих номерам 4 и 5 триггеров 3.

Фо рм ул а и з о б р е т е н и я

Составитель А. Мишин

Техред M.Õoäàíè÷ Корректор M. Васильева

Редактор Л. Пчолийская

Заказ 2158/50 Тираж 669 Подписное

ВНИИПИ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Р

113035, Москва, Ж-35, Раушская наб., д. 4/5

Производственно-издательский комбинат "Патент", r.Óærîðoä, ул. Гагарина,101 делей 7 4 и 7, и исключение из топологии сети ребер (В, Д), (Б, Г) . При выдаче распределителем 2 импульса по четвертому выходу вначале проис5 ходит переход в нулевое состояние третьего триггера 3, что приводит к закрытию ключа 9 модели 7,18, разрыву цепи протекания тока между вершинами А и Д и исчезновению сигнала уровня "1" на входе элемента 6, образовавшийся при этом импульс поступает на вход признака останова генератора 1 и прекращает работу устройства. Кроме того, он проходит через четвертый элемент И 4, открытый по второму входу потенциалом с четвертого выхода распределителя 2, и возвращает в единичное состояние четвертый триггер 3. Номер (4) этого триггера 3, первым сохранившего единичное состояние в группе триг- геров 3, указывает узкое место в пути между вершинами А и Д, так как в графе не осталось ребер меньшего веса. Включенные элементы 8 индикации на моделях 7, 7, 7 указывают ребра пути между вершинами

А и Д. Если через узкое место проходит несколько путей, то соответствующие элементы индикации 8 указы вают ветви, через которые они проходят. Наличие двух и более узких мест .проверяется пользователем путем сравнения весов ребер, соответствующих триггерам 3 с большими номерами. Например, если в рассмотренном графе вес ребра (Г, Д) был равен 4, а управляющий вход ключа 9 модели

7 подключен к выходу пятого тригГ

40 гера 3, то узкое (второе) место пользователь установил бы путем сравнения весов ребер (А, В) и

Устройство для анализа параметров сетей, содержащее группу из P триггеров (где Р— количество ребер в сети), группу из P элементов И и блок определения связных вершин сети, причем выход К-го элемента

И группы (К = I, P) подключен к входу установки в "1" К-ro триггера группы, выход которого подключен к входу признака удаления К-го ребра блока определения связных вершин сети, о т л и ч а ю щ е е с я тем, что, с целью расширения функциональных возможностей устройства эа счет определения узких мест в пути между начальной и конечной вершинами сети, в него введены генератор импульсов, распределитель импульсов и элемент НЕ, причем вход пуска устройства подключен к входу пуска генератора импульсов, выход которого подключен к тактовому входу распределителя импульсов, К-й . выход которого подключен к входу установки в "0" К-го триггера группы и первому входу К-ro элемента группы, вход разрешения работы устройства подключен к входу опроса начальной вершины блока определения связных вершин сети, выход признака связности конечной вершины которого подключен к входу элемента

НЕ, выход которого является выходом признака окончания работы устройства и подключен к входу признака останова генератора импульсов и вторым входам всех элементов И группы.

Устройство для анализа параметров сетей Устройство для анализа параметров сетей Устройство для анализа параметров сетей 

 

Похожие патенты:

Изобретение относится к вычислительной технике и может быть использовано для решения транспортных задач линейного программирования

Изобретение относится к области вьгаислительной техники и может быть использовано для упорядочения двумерных массивов чисел по строкам (столбцам ) массива

Изобретение относится к вычислительной технике, может быть использовано для решения задач теории расписаний и позволяет минимизировать суммарное время исполнения технологически зависимых заданий

Изобретение относится к вычислительной технике и может быть использовано для решения задач на графах, связанных с определением абсолютного внешнего центра графой, являкяцихся математическими моделями сетей связи, информационно-расчетных систем и т.д

Изобретение относится к вычислительной технике и может быть использовано при моделировании баз данных , изменение объема которых представлено в виде изменения числа вершин в уровнях реализации случайного леса с заданной высотой, случайным общим числом вершин и порождаемого случайным ветвящимся процессом с одним типом частиц

Изобретение относится к электронному моделированию и может быть использовано при решении задач выбора параметров для контроля работоспособности технических объектов и для определения стратегии контроля

Изобретение относится к вычислительной технике и может быть использовано д

Изобретение относится к вычислительной технике и может быть использовано для решения задач нахождения оптимального дерева связности неориентированных графов

Изобретение относится к аналоговой вычислительной технике и может быть использовано для нахождения абсолютных внешних центров графов

Изобретение относится к системам ориентации и управления движением космических аппаратов при реализации программных разворотов

Изобретение относится к автоматике и вычислительной технике и может быть использовано в системах обработки изображений и распознавания образов

Изобретение относится к автоматике и аналоговой вычислительной технике и может быть использовано для построения функциональных узлов аналоговых вычислительных машин

Изобретение относится к вычислительной технике и может быть использовано в аналоговых вычислительных машинах

Изобретение относится к вычислительной технике и может быть использовано в аналоговых вычислительных машинах

Изобретение относится к вычислительной технике и может быть использовано при автоматизации процессов управления различными сетями

Изобретение относится к области вычислительной техники и может быть использовано в аналоговых вычислительных устройствах

Изобретение относится к области вычислительной техники и может найти применение при проектировании сложных систем

Изобретение относится к области вычислительной техники и может найти применение в сложных системах при выборе оптимальных решений из ряда возможных вариантов

Изобретение относится к области вычислительной техники и может найти применение в сложных системах при выборе оптимальных решений из ряда возможных вариантов
Наверх